Product Portfolio

Comprehensive range of high-performance polymers and specialty chemicals

Polyethylene

High-density, low-density, and linear grades

Density: 0.91-0.97 g/cm³ Melting Point: 120-135°C

Polypropylene

Homopolymer and copolymer variants

Density: 0.90-0.91 g/cm³ Melting Point: 160-166°C

PET Resins

Bottle, fiber, and film grade applications

Density: 1.38-1.41 g/cm³ Melting Point: 250-260°C

ABS Resins

High impact and flame retardant grades

Density: 1.04-1.06 g/cm³ Glass Transition: 105°C
